Sacramento, January 2th, 1881
An adjourned meeting of the board of
officers was held at Judge Haines office
at 10 1/2 o'clock A.M.
Mr. L. Elkus president in the chair.
All officers was noted present
except Mr. Hamburger, Weinstock, and Lubin.
The minutes of last meeting was read
and approved.
Application of
Mr. Isidor Levison of Rocklin to become
a member was read and on motion
the application was received and Mr. Levison
a member of this congregation.
The resignation of Mr. G.S. Nathan
was read and on motion accepted.
Also the resignation of Mr. Albert Elkus
was read and on motion accepted.
The committee on donation made partial
report and asked further time,
and on motion further time was granted.
The following bills was allowed.
M. Wilson for collecting $25.00
N. Mohns taking care of cemetery 15.00
W.J. Rand Organist 15.00
S. Morris advertising and 8 blank music books 4.75
County taxes 59.40
Wilson and Mitchell [Note 1] 2 carriages 8.00
Rev Dr. J. Bloch 1 Bible 8.75
------------------
Total $125.90 [Note 2]
There being no further business
the meeting adjourned.
S.Morris
Secretary
[Note 1: Wilson & Mitchell carriages, 1895 city directory]
[Note 2: Should be $135.90]
